Ir para conteúdo
  • Cadastre-se

Juliomar Marchetti

Consultores
  • Total de ítens

    46.558
  • Registro em

  • Última visita

  • Days Won

    366

Tudo que Juliomar Marchetti postou

  1. manda o cliente abrir chamado. lá e na prefeitura assim resolve manda todos que dai eles olham o volume
  2. acho que todos pois está fora. abrir chamado no sefaz é o melhor caminho
  3. fecha seu delphi e roda o instalador abra novamente e teste
  4. e2eid tem no manual do pix do bacen onde sugiro ler antes de continuar a implementação, pois lá irá notar tratamentos , retornos e informações para quando ocorrer em seu cliente. além do manual da psp que estiver usando. e2eid é o ID que é gerado quando o pix txid é pago. assim tu usa para consultar caso precisar estornar ou validar e tu informa ele nos documentos fiscais. consulta de for ambiente de homologação não tem no sicredi tu só vai conseguir em produção efetuar pagamentos de pix e testar
  5. Tente trocar a internet ou dns? ou modificar o componente para aumentar o timeout ou ajuste para ele efetuar mais tentativas
  6. Tente fazer o seguinte, usar interface pra trabalhar . sugestão é claro unit CEPInterface; interface uses ACBrCEP, SysUtils, Classes; type // Interface para encapsular TEndereco IEndereco = interface ['{59E04EAB-9B4F-4F3E-A52B-AD8AB3422193}'] function GetLogradouro: string; function GetBairro: string; function GetMunicipio: string; function GetUF: string; property Logradouro: string read GetLogradouro; property Bairro: string read GetBairro; property Municipio: string read GetMunicipio; property UF: string read GetUF; end; // Implementação da interface IEndereco TEnderecoWrapper = class(TInterfacedObject, IEndereco) private FEndereco: TEndereco; public constructor Create(AEndereco: TEndereco); function GetLogradouro: string; function GetBairro: string; function GetMunicipio: string; function GetUF: string; end; // Interface para consulta de CEP IConsultaCEP = interface ['{6EC7376C-9D40-4113-9FFD-775A1C3D819A}'] function Consultar(const CEP: string): IEndereco; end; // Implementação da interface de consulta TConsultaCEP = class(TInterfacedObject, IConsultaCEP) private FACBrCEP: TACBrCEP; public constructor Create; destructor Destroy; override; function Consultar(const CEP: string): IEndereco; end; implementation { TEnderecoWrapper } constructor TEnderecoWrapper.Create(AEndereco: TEndereco); begin FEndereco := AEndereco; end; function TEnderecoWrapper.GetLogradouro: string; begin Result := FEndereco.Logradouro; end; function TEnderecoWrapper.GetBairro: string; begin Result := FEndereco.Bairro; end; function TEnderecoWrapper.GetMunicipio: string; begin Result := FEndereco.Municipio; end; function TEnderecoWrapper.GetUF: string; begin Result := FEndereco.UF; end; { TConsultaCEP } constructor TConsultaCEP.Create; begin FACBrCEP := TACBrCEP.Create(nil); FACBrCEP.WebService := wsCorreios; // Configuração do WebService desejado end; destructor TConsultaCEP.Destroy; begin FACBrCEP.Free; inherited; end; function TConsultaCEP.Consultar(const CEP: string): IEndereco; begin FACBrCEP.BuscarPorCEP(CEP); // Realiza a consulta pelo CEP if FACBrCEP.Enderecos.Count > 0 then // Retorna um wrapper para o primeiro endereço encontrado Result := TEnderecoWrapper.Create(FACBrCEP.Enderecos[0]) else raise Exception.CreateFmt('CEP %s não encontrado.', [CEP]); end; end. e use assim uses CEPInterface; // Unit com a interface e implementação var ConsultaCEP: IConsultaCEP; Endereco: IEndereco; begin // Criando a implementação ConsultaCEP := TConsultaCEP.Create; // Consultando um CEP Writeln('Consultando o CEP 01001-000...'); Endereco := ConsultaCEP.Consultar('01001-000'); // CEP de exemplo // Exibindo os dados retornados Writeln('Logradouro: ', Endereco.Logradouro); Writeln('Bairro: ', Endereco.Bairro); Writeln('Cidade: ', Endereco.Municipio); Writeln('Estado: ', Endereco.UF); não se preocupe em destruir pois ele se encarrega.
  7.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  8. em princípio seria esse. pois ele não consegue retornar o token e dai não ocorre mais nada consegue conferir que está certo as credenciais?
  9. Sugestão é entrar em contato com eles para saber mais mas se verificar no log do svn vai ver a implementação anteriores e baixar para testar segundo o que tem descrito em tópicos é que será modificado ou algo assim a API deles mas sugestão é falar com eles
  10. Como está usando o ACBrCEP em sua aplicação? o que pode estar ocorrendo é criando varias instâncias do componente
  11. dll do openssl 1.0 superior. junto a sua aplicação?
  12. só pra confirmar é a Architect que tu tens?
  13. verifica como está informando os daods do nosso numero e a quebra de linha abre no notepad++ e veja se tem a finalizadora
  14. Não sei se te conta nele ou é a gratuita. mas lembro que tem limites de consultas. será que não é isso
  15. Obrigado por reportar. Fechando. Para novas dúvidas, criar um novo tópico.
  16. só complementar, TLS 1.2 senão ele fica tentando os outros e pode dar erros
  17. Muda rota de DNS pra ver. testa 8.8.8.8 ou 1.1.1.1 ou outro ou até mesmo internet de outro provedor diferente ou um 3G 4G 5G
  18. Isso no componente ACBrNFe? ou tem a ver com banco de dados?
  19. seu problema está ligado diretamente a instalação do Delphi qual ISO ou Webinstall está usando? foi o enviado pela Embarcadero ou usou o da versão trial ele registra no registro do windows key e values que são usados para saber então senão instalou é algo com a instalação o delphi sugiro entrar em contato com o suporte da embarcadero para validar o instalador ou iso usada
  20. dai é também a config que tá usando no componente SSLIB wincrypt ssltype tls 1.2
  21. Manda salvar os arquivos soaps de envio e retorno e veja se no retorno tem informações
  22. isso deve ocorrer na epoca de pico de emissão de NFSe não é? talvez seja gargalo deles . tente personalizar o ajuste de numero de tentativas e tempo no componente
  23. Como disse tem que ver se está abrindo e passando os parametros correto em runtime. com isso tu faz usando o debug do delphi, coloca pontos de paradas onde tu passa os parametros
  24. O ACBrMonitor e também o ACBrLib são opensource o que é PRO é a compilação seja do executavel quanto da dll mas se tu sabe pascal é só compilar mas o valor é para ajudar o projeto é quase um valor simbolico e tu não precisa ir fazer algo que não é de seu know how além de ter forum privado com SLA( tempo para resposta rapido) e canais do discord, tem cursos entre outras coisas. então vale a pena assinar pra não ficar a compilar pois tu tem que saber usar além de ter que atualizar svn toda vez
  25. Não sei como fez, mas ao que tudo indica ou não filtrou correto ou não está abrindo essa query
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.

The popup will be closed in 10 segundos...